PHP ищет подходящие изображения с GD - PullRequest
0 голосов
/ 26 апреля 2011

У меня есть папка с размером около 2000 изображений размером 37x13, когда я добавляю новое изображение, я хочу найти идеальный пиксель , прежде чем добавить его в папку.

Чтомне нужна функция соответствия, возвращающая true или false, чтобы я мог реагировать, если есть совпадение.Я полагаю, что это можно сделать с помощью imagick, но он не установлен, и я хотел бы сделать это без установки imagick.

Итак, что я спрашиваю, есть ли способ увидеть, идеально ли изображение соответствует другому с PHP / GD?

Ответы [ 2 ]

1 голос
/ 26 апреля 2011

Я сам не пробовал, но я бы предположил, что использование hash_file сработает для того, что вы пытаетесь сделать.

Хешируйте оба файла, используя hash_file и сравнивайте их. Если они совпадают, то изображения должны быть одинаковыми.

1 голос
/ 26 апреля 2011

Как насчет хеширования файла?

http://ca2.php.net/manual/en/function.sha1-file.php

...